Religion Among Children and Youth: Learning by Doing

when 22 August 2022 - 27 August 2022
language Dutch
duration 1 week
credits 5 EC
fee EUR 460

Pastors and youth workers in churches, teachers in Christian education, faithful parents: all try in their own way and from their own responsibility to support children and young people in their faith development. They do this from the awareness that there is something to learn: faith develops, individually and in community, and upbringing, education and child and youth work supports that development. But what is the relationship between faith and learning? This summer colloquium will reflect on this question from recent practical theological research.

Course leader

Dr. Ronelle Sonnenberg is assistant professor of Practical Theology/ Youth Ministry at the Protestantse Theologische Universiteit, Amsterdam.

Prof. Dr. Jos de Kock is professor of Practical Theology at the Evangelische Theologische Faculteit, Leuven.

Target group

Our Summer Colloquium is compulsory for ETF Open University students open to interested people with academic qualifications and can serve as additional in-service training for pastors, teachers, and other ministry professionals.
